Sun Java logo     Capítulo anterior      Índice      Capítulo siguiente     

Sun logo
Sun Java System Identity Installation Pack 2005Q4M3 Notas de la versión  

4

Anexos a la documentación y correcciones

El componente que aparece junto a este título es el número de capítulo (CN).


Acerca de las guías de software del sistema Identity

La documentación de software del sistema Identity está organizada en varias guías, que se suministran en formato de Acrobat (.pdf) en el CD Identity Install Pack. La versión incluye las siguientes guías.

Software del sistema Identity

Install Pack Installation (Identity_Install_Pack_Installation_2005Q4M3.pdf) — Describe cómo instalar y actualizar el software del sistema Identity.

Identity Manager

Identity Auditor

Identity Auditor Administration (IDA_Administration_2005Q4M3.pdf) - Ofrece una introducción a la interfaz del administrador de Identity Auditor.

Identity Manager Service Provider Edition


Utilización de las guías en línea

Para desplazarse por las guías, utilice la función Marcadores de Acrobat. Haga clic en el nombre de una sección en el panel de marcadores para desplazarse a la posición que ocupa dicha sección en el documento.

La serie de documentos de Identity Manager se pueden consultar desde cualquier instalación de Identity Manager desplazándose hasta idm/doc en el explorador Web.


Install Pack Installation

Información añadida

Con la incorporación de información nueva se pretende mejorar los procesos de instalación y actualización.

Correcciones


Guía Identity Manager Administration

Información añadida


Identity Manager Technical Deployment Overview

El análisis de los flujos de trabajo, los formularios y las páginas JSP relacionados pertenece a la descripción de la arquitectura incluida en Identity Manager Technical Deployment Overview (ID-7332).

Process Execution

When a user enters data into a field on a page and clicks Save, view, workflow and form components work together to execute the processes necessary to process the data.

Each page in Identity Manager has a view, workflow and form associated with it that performs the necessary data processing. These workflow, view, and form associations are listed in the following two tables.

Identity Manager User Interface Processes

The following tables indicate the forms, views and workflows that are involved in processes initiated from the following Identity Manager User Interface pages:

User Interface

Page

 

Form

 

 

View

 

 

Workflow

 

 

Main menu

• endUserMenu

• default End User Menu

User

View is read-only. No modifications can be made on this page

none

Change Password

• endUserChangePassword

• default Change Password Form

Password

• changeUser
Password

• default Change User Password

Change Other Account Attributes

• endUserForm

• default End User Form

User

Update User

Check Process Status

• endUserTaskList

• default End User Task List

List

View includes information on TaskInstance objects launched by the user

none

Process Status

Page is generated by the TaskViewResults class

none

none

none

Available Processes

• endUserLaunchList

• default End User Launch List

List

View includes information on TaskDefinition objects accessible to the user

none

Launch Process

Launches a selected TaskDefinition

Defined by the TaskDefinition

Process

none

Change Answers to Authentication Questions

• changeAnswers

• default Change User Answers Form

ChangeUserAnswers

none

Self Discovery

Can link to existing resource accounts only

• selfDiscovery

• default Self Discovery

User

Update User

Inbox

• endUserWorkItemList

• default End User Work Item List

List

View contains information about WorkItems directly owned by the current user

none

Inbox Item Edit

Specified by WorkItem or auto-generated

WorkItem

none

Administrator Interface Processes

The following tables identify the forms, views, workflows, and JSPs that are involved in processes initiated from these Identity Manager Administrator Interface pages:

Administrator Interface

Page

 

Form

 

 

 

View

 

 

 

Workflow

 

 

 

Create Organization and Edit Organization

System Configuration mapping

Depending upon context, can be one of several forms, including:

• Organization Form

• Organization Rename Form

• Directory Junction Form

• Virtual Organization Form

• Virtual Organization Refresh Form

Org

none

Create User

• userForm

• default Tabbed User Form

User

• createUser

• default Create User

Update User

• userForm

• default Tabbed User Form

User

• updateUser

• default Update User

Disable User’s Resource Accounts

• disableUser

• default Disable User

Disable

• disableUser

• default Disable User

Rename User

• renameUser

• default Rename User Form

RenameUser

• renameUser

• default Rename User

Update User’s Resource Accounts

• reprovisionUser

• default Reprovision Form

Reprovision

• updateUser

• default Update User

Unlock User’s Resource Accounts

• unlockUser

• default Unlock User

Unlock

• unlockUser

• default Unlock User

Delete User’s Resource Accounts

• deprovisionUser

• default Deprovision Form

Deprovision

• deleteUser

• default Delete User

Change User Password

Uses same workflow as end-user GUI, but different form

• changePassword

• default Change User Password Form

ChangeUserPassword

• changeUserPassword

• default Change User Password

Reset User Password

• resetPassword

• default Reset User Password Form

ResetUserPassword

• changeUserPassword

• default Change User Password

Change My Password

Same view, form, and workflow as End-User Change Password but different JSP

• endUserChangePassword

• default Change Password Form

Password

• changeUserPassword

• default Change User Password

Change My Answers

Same view, form as End-User Change Answers but different JSP

• changeAnswers

• default Change User Answers Form

ChangeUserAnswers

none

Approvals

• workItemList

• default Work Item List

• default form includes Work Item Confirmation

WorkItemList

 

none

Edit WorkItem

Check in of the WorkItem view results in the resumption of the workflow that created it, but no workflow is created just to process the work item checkin

Specified by WorkItem, or auto-generated

WorkItem

none

Launch Task

Launches a selected TaskDefinition

Defined by the TaskDefinition

Process

none

Create and Update Scheduled Tasks

no System Configuration mapping, default Task Schedule Form, merged with TaskDefinition form

This form is generated by combining the TaskDefinition form with Task Schedule Form as a wrapper

TaskSchedule

none

Create Role and Edit Role

no System Configuration mapping

The default Role Form and Role Rename Form depend on context

Role

• manageRole

• default Manage Role

Edit Resource

no System Configuration mapping, depends on context, forms include:

• Change Resource Account Password Form

• Reset Resource Account Password Form

• Edit Resource Policy Form

• Resource Rename Form

• Resource Wizard <resource type>

• Resource Wizard.

Allows type-specific wizard forms, default to Resource Wizard

Resource

• manageResource

• default Manage Resource

Edit Capability

changeCapabilities, default Change User Capabilities Form

ChangeUserCapabilities

none

Java Server Pages (JSPs) and Their Role in Identity Manager

The following tables describe the JSPs that are shipped with the system as well as their Administrator and User Interface pages.

JSPs for Identity Manager User Interface

Page

Associated JSP

Main Menu

user/main.jsp

Change Password

user/changePassword.jsp

Change Other Account Attributes

user/changeAll.jsp

Check Process Status

user/processStatusList.jsp

Process Status

user/processStatus.jsp

Available Processes

user/processList.jsp

Launch Process

user/processLaunch.jsp

Change Answers to Authentication Questions

user/changeAnswers.jsp

Self Discovery

user/selfDiscover.jsp

Inbox

user/workItemList.jsp

Inbox Item Edit

user/workItemEdit.jsp

JSPs for Admin Interface

Page

Associated JSP

Create Organization and Edit Organization

security/orgedit.jsp

Create User

account/modify.jsp

Update User

account/modify.jsp

Disable User’s Resource Accounts

account/resourceDisable.jsp

Rename User

account/renameUser.jsp

Update User’s Resource Accounts

account/resourceReprovision.jsp

Unlock User’s Resource Accounts

admin/resourceUnlock.jsp

Delete User’s Resource Accounts

account/resourceDeprovision.jsp

Change User Password

admin/changeUserPassword.jsp

Reset User Password

admin/resetUserPassword.jsp

Change My Password

admin/changeself.jsp

Change My Answers

admin/changeAnswers.jsp

Approvals

approval/approval.jsp

Edit WorkItem

approval/itemEdit.jsp

Launch Tasks

task/taskLaunch.jsp

Create and Update Scheduled Tasks

task/editSchedule.jsp

Create Role and Edit Role

roles/applicationmodify.jsp

Edit Resource

resources/modify.jsp

Edit Capability

account/modifyCapabilities.jsp


Ajuste, solución de problemas y mensajes de error en Identity Manager

Información añadida

Ahora puede utilizar la función de seguimiento estándar de com.waveset.task.Scheduler para realizar un seguimiento del programador de tareas si una tarea presenta problemas.

Para obtener más información, consulte Tracing the Identity Manager Server en Ajuste, solución de problemas y mensajes de error en Sun Java™ System Identity Manager.

Correcciones

Como necesita instalar JDK 1.4.2 en esta versión, las instrucciones para eliminar los archivos Cryptix jar (cryptix-jceapi.jar y cryptix-jce-provider.jar) del directorio idm\WEB-INF\lib que se proporcionan en el capítulo 1: Performance Tuning, Optimizing the J2EE Environment, ya no sirven (a menos que actualice una versión anterior de Identity Manager).


Utilización de helpTool

En Identity Manager 6.0 se ha añadido una nueva función que permite realizar búsquedas en la ayuda en línea y los archivos de documentación, que se encuentran en formato HTML. El motor de búsqueda se basa en la tecnología de motor de búsqueda SunLabs “Nova”.

El motor Nova funciona en dos fases: indexación y recuperación. Durante la fase de indexación se analizan los documentos introducidos y se crea un índice que se utiliza durante la fase de recuperación. Durante la recuperación es posible extraer “fragmentos” incluidos en contexto en el que se encontraron los términos de la consulta. El proceso de recuperación de fragmentos requiere que los archivos HTML originales estén presentes, motivo por el cual deben residir en una ubicación del sistema de archivos a la que pueda acceder el motor de búsqueda.

helpTool es un programa de Java que realiza dos funciones básicas:

helpTool se ejecuta desde la línea de comandos como sigue:

$ java -jar helpTool.jar

usage: HelpTool

-d Destination directory

-h This help information

-i Directory or JAR containing input files, no wildcards

-n Directory for Nova index

-o Output file name

-p Indexing properties file

Reconstrucción/recreación del índice de la ayuda en línea

Los archivos HTML de la ayuda en línea se empaquetan en un archivo JAR. Para que el motor de búsqueda funcione, debe extraerlos a un directorio. Realice el siguiente procedimiento:

  1. Descomprima helpTool en un directorio temporal. (Detalles TBD)
  2. En este ejemplo, los archivos se van a extraer en /tmp/helpTool.

  3. En el intérprete de comandos de UNIX o en la ventana de comandos de Windows, cambie el directorio a la ubicación del contenedor Web en el que se ha implementado la aplicación Identity Manager.
  4. Por ejemplo, el siguiente podría ser un directorio de Sun Java System Application Server:

    /opt/SUNWappserver/domains/domain1/applications/j2ee-modules/idm

  5. Cambie el directorio de trabajo actual a help/.

  6. Nota Es importante ejecutar helpTool desde este directorio. De lo contrario, el índice no se generará correctamente. Además, debería borrar los archivos de índice anteriores eliminando el contenido del subdirectorio index/help/.

  7. Recopile la siguiente información para los argumentos de la línea de comandos:

Directorio de destino:

html/help/en_US

Nota: Utilice la cadena de configuración regional adecuada.

Archivos de entrada:

../WEB-INF/lib/idm.jar

Directorio de índice Nova:

index/help

Nombre de archivo de salida:

index_files_help.txt

Nota: El nombre del archivo no es importante, pero la herramienta se cerrará si ya existe.

Archivo de propiedades de indexación:

index/index.properties

  1. Ejecute el comando siguiente:
  2. $ java -jar /tmp/helpTool/helpTool.jar -d html/help/en_US -i ../
    WEB-INF/lib/idm.jar -n index/help -o help_files_help.txt -p index/index.properties

    Extracted 475 files.

    [15/Dec/2005:13:11:38] PM Init index/help AWord 1085803878

    [15/Dec/2005:13:11:38] PM Making meta file: index/help/MF: 0

    [15/Dec/2005:13:11:38] PM Created active file: index/help/AL

    [15/Dec/2005:13:11:40] MP Partition: 1, 475 documents, 5496 terms.

    [15/Dec/2005:13:11:40] MP Finished dumping: 1 index/help 0.266

    [15/Dec/2005:13:11:40] IS 475 documents, 6.56 MB, 2.11 s, 11166.66 MB/h

    [15/Dec/2005:13:11:40] PM Waiting for housekeeper to finish

    [15/Dec/2005:13:11:41] PM Shutdown index/help AWord 1085803878

Reconstrucción/recreación del índice de la documentación

Para reconstruir o volver a crear el índice de la documentación, realice el siguiente procedimiento:

  1. Descomprima helpTool en un directorio temporal. (Detalles TBD)
  2. En este ejemplo, los archivos se van a extraer en /tmp/helpTool.

  3. En el intérprete de comandos de UNIX o en la ventana de comandos de Windows, cambie el directorio a la ubicación del contenedor Web en el que se ha implementado la aplicación Identity Manager.
  4. Por ejemplo, el siguiente podría ser un directorio de Sun Java System Application Server:

    /opt/SUNWappserver/domains/domain1/applications/j2ee-modules/idm

  5. Cambie el directorio de trabajo actual a help/.

  6. Nota helpTool se debe ejecutar desde este directorio. De lo contrario, el índice no se generará correctamente. Además, debería borrar los archivos de índice anteriores eliminando el contenido del subdirectorio index/docs/.

  7. Recopile la siguiente información para los argumentos de la línea de comandos:

Directorio de destino:

html/docs

Archivos de entrada:

../doc/HTML/en_US

Nota: La herramienta copiará el directorio en_US/ y los subdirectorios en el destino.

Directorio de índice Nova:

index/docs

Nombre de archivo de salida:

index_files_docs.txt

Nota: El nombre del archivo no es importante, pero la herramienta se cerrará si ya existe.

Archivo de propiedades de indexación:

index/index.properties

  1. Ejecute el comando siguiente:
  2. $ java -jar /tmp/helpTool/helpTool.jar -d html/docs -i ../doc/HTML/en_US -n index/docs -o help_files_docs.txt -p index/index.properties

    Copied 84 files.

    Copied 105 files.

    Copied 1 files.

    Copied 15 files.

    Copied 1 files.

    Copied 58 files.

    Copied 134 files.

    Copied 156 files.

    Copied 116 files.

    Copied 136 files.

    Copied 21 files.

    Copied 37 files.

    Copied 1 files.

    Copied 13 files.

    Copied 2 files.

    Copied 19 files.

    Copied 20 files.

    Copied 52 files.

    Copied 3 files.

    Copied 14 files.

    Copied 3 files.

    Copied 3 files.

    Copied 608 files.

    [15/Dec/2005:13:24:25] PM Init index/docs AWord 1252155067

    [15/Dec/2005:13:24:25] PM Making meta file: index/docs/MF: 0

    [15/Dec/2005:13:24:25] PM Created active file: index/docs/AL

    [15/Dec/2005:13:24:28] MP Partition: 1, 192 documents, 38488 terms.

    [15/Dec/2005:13:24:29] MP Finished dumping: 1 index/docs 0.617

    [15/Dec/2005:13:24:29] IS 192 documents, 14.70 MB, 3.81 s, 13900.78 MB/h

    [15/Dec/2005:13:24:29] PM Waiting for housekeeper to finish

    [15/Dec/2005:13:24:30] PM Shutdown index/docs AWord 1252155067



Capítulo anterior      Índice      Capítulo siguiente     


Copyright 2006 Sun Microsystems, Inc. Todos los derechos reservados.